Pre-school Education

Asked by Alex BrewerLiberal DemocratDepartment for EducationTabled Answered 8 September 2026UIN 24677

The question

To ask the Secretary of State for Education, what steps the Government is taking to support parents and carers in preparing children for starting school.

Answered by Department for Education

The government is supporting parents and carers to prepare children for school through a wider package of measures to improve school readiness to meet the government’s ambition for 75% of children to reach a good level of development in Reception by the end of 2028.

Best Start Family Hubs provide accessible parenting and home learning support in every local authority, including stay and play, story and rhyme sessions, and practical advice on chatting, playing and reading together. Hubs also help families understand and access childcare entitlements and high-quality early education, and every hub will have a Best Start Inclusion Practitioner to identify emerging additional needs early and support children through the transition to Reception.

The government has also completed expansion of 30 hours of funded childcare and early education for eligible working parents of children from nine months old and continues to drive take up of the universal 15-hour early education entitlements for two, three and four-year-olds, giving children more opportunities to benefit from high-quality early education before starting school. Further, the government has published guidance for schools and early years providers on effective transitions and is funding Early Education Partnerships to strengthen links between settings and schools.
